The aim of the course is to get the students acquainted with history of zoology, define of scientific branches in zoology; Chemistry of cell (inorganic and organic molecules); The cell: protoplasm, organeles, nucleus, cell division and protein synthesis; Organisation of living things: Hystlogy (epithelia tissue, connective tissue, muscular tissue, nervous tissue); reproduction: asexual, sexual; Classifications of animals
History of zoology, define of scientific branches in zoology Chemistry of cell (inorganic and organic molecules); - general features of cell structures of cells: cell membrane, protoplasm, organeles: (endoplasmic reticulum, ribosome, mitokondrium, Golgi complex, lysosome, centrosome, vacuol), nucleus; prokaryotic and eukaryotic cells, The cell division, gametogenesis, protein synthesis. Reproduction, embryology Organisation of living things, tissues Classifications of animals, unicellular and multicellular organisms. Laboratuvar: Microscope and cell, divisions, samples of animal tissue types.
